SEPA produces the Catalog of Standards (CoS) as a reference to the Electric Grid community with the intent of it serving as a useful resource for utilities, manufacturers, regulators, consumers, and other Industry Grid stakeholders. The Catalog is a compendium of standards and practices considered to be relevant for the development and deployment of a robust, interoperable, and secure Modern/Smart Grid.

Each standard listed in the Catalog contains extensive information and has gone through a rigorous, multi-part review using objective criteria by industry experts. The Catalog also provides a key, non-exclusive, source of input to the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) process for coordinating the development of a framework of protocols and model standards for an interoperable Smart Grid.
